£10K HARRY WAND FOR ROMANOV
CONTROVERSIAL Hearts owner Vladimir Romanov has forked out £10,000 to buy Harry Potter's wand.
He went head-to-head with tycoon and ardent Hibs fan Sir Tom Farmer at a charity auction in Edinburgh on Friday.
Sir Tom finally bowed out of the bidding at £10,000, leaving the Lithuanian banker with the prized wooden wand.
Romanov attended the charity night for the One City Trust, which tackles poverty in Edinburgh, after flying back to Scotland with Hearts coach Valdas Ivanauskas.
He was optimistic the wand would help the team recover their form.
Hearts spokesman David Southern said: "Let's hope he can weave some magic now he's back."
